What Is the Evil Eye?

The evil eye is a belief that certain individuals can cast a malevolent glare, often unwittingly, that causes harm or misfortune to others. This concept is prevalent in many cultures, including those in the Mediterranean, Middle East, and parts of Asia. To counteract this perceived threat, people use talismans or amulets, often called "evil eyes," which are designed to ward off negative energy.

Do Evil Eye Colors Hold Different Meanings?

Evil eye amulets come in various colors, each believed to offer distinct forms of protection:

  • Blue: Most common and traditional, representing protection and good karma.
  • Red: Symbolizes courage, energy, and protection from fears and anxieties.
  • Green: Associated with growth, development, and balance.
  • Yellow: Linked to health, concentration, and relief from exhaustion.
  • Black: Offers protection, power, and strength, absorbing negative energy.

The choice of color can be deeply personal, often reflecting individual needs or cultural traditions rather than any inherent power associated with rarity.

What Is the Origin of the Evil Eye Belief?

The origin of the evil eye belief dates back to ancient Greece and Rome, where it was thought that envious looks could cause harm. This belief has since spread to various cultures worldwide, each adapting the concept to fit their traditions.

Are Evil Eye Colors Important in Different Cultures?

Yes, different cultures attribute various meanings to evil eye colors. For example, in Turkey, the blue evil eye is considered traditional, while in some Middle Eastern cultures, other colors might hold special significance.
